Product Overview

The SMDJ54A-HRA belongs to the category of transient voltage suppressor diodes. These diodes are used to protect sensitive electronic devices from voltage spikes and surges. The SMDJ54A-HRA is characterized by its high reliability, fast response time, and low clamping voltage. It is typically packaged in a surface-mount design and is available in various quantities per package.

Basic Information

  • Category: Transient Voltage Suppressor Diode
  • Use: Protection against voltage spikes and surges
  • Characteristics: High reliability, fast response time, low clamping voltage
  • Package: Surface-mount
  • Packaging/Quantity: Various quantities per package

Specifications

  • Part Number: SMDJ54A-HRA
  • Peak Pulse Power: 3000W
  • Breakdown Voltage: 54V
  • Operating Temperature Range: -55°C to +150°C
  • Package Type: DO-214AB (SMC)

Working Principles

The SMDJ54A-HRA operates based on the principle of avalanche breakdown, where it rapidly conducts excess voltage away from sensitive components, thereby protecting them from damage.
